According to the Oceania website, category E cabins do not have a sofa. I asked one of their reservation agents, and they said they weren't sure about additional seating. I'm wondering if someone who has seen a category E cabin tell me about the seating arrangements. I believe these cabins are slightly smaller than the others. I do know they have obstructed views. I currently have a category D on 02 Jan 07 but prefer a larger window (even if obstructed) to the porthole. Can't wait. Thanks.

When I look at the Oceania site, it states that category E is 143 sf and has no sofa. This is found in "Explore the Ships", "Suites and Staterooms", and then click "on ocean view." The reservation agent told me it does not have a sofa but couldn't tell me about alternate seating except sitting on the bed.

We are trying cat E on March 8!! We had the opportunity to look at one on our Transatlantic last year. Definitely smaller and the one we were in was turned 90 degrees as its length was fore and aft. No sofa but otherwise we expect everything else to be the same.
